Mypresso Traditional and Fully Automatic Espresso Machines

At an espresso station, whether the machine is manual or automatic determines the barista's role. A traditional machine leaves grind, dose, and tamp control to the operator; a fully automatic machine manages these steps itself based on a saved recipe. Mypresso covers both approaches with the Q2 TC traditional group-head machine and the Mypresso Auto bean-to-cup system.

Mypresso Q2 TC Two-Group Traditional Machine

The Q2 TC is a traditional portafilter espresso machine with two brew groups. It is listed with an 11-liter boiler, PID temperature control, and a Tall Cup design that allows taller glasses to fit under the group heads.

The barista fills, tamps, and locks the portafilter, and the machine manages water pressure and temperature during the shot. Shot quality still depends heavily on the operator's grind, dose, and tamping consistency.

PID Control and Shot Timer

PID control is oriented toward keeping brew water temperature more stable across the shot. The manufacturer's stated benefit is a narrower temperature swing than a simple thermostat system provides.

The Q2 TC's shot timer and coffee-water counters help the barista track extraction time and monitor daily usage. These counters do not replace a taste test; grind and dose should still be checked against the cup result.

Volumetric Brass Pump and Pre-Infusion

The Q2 TC uses a volumetric brass pump to control water delivery per shot. Pre-infusion is oriented toward wetting the coffee bed gently before full pressure is applied, which can help even extraction.

Pre-infusion timing and pressure ramp should be adjusted based on the roast and grind being used; a single fixed setting will not suit every bean.

Tall Cup Design and Dual Steam Wands

The Tall Cup group-head height is oriented toward fitting larger glasses and takeaway cups directly under the portafilter without needing a riser. The Q2 TC includes two steam wands, allowing two milk pitchers to be steamed independently.

Two independent steam wands can help reduce wait time during a busy morning rush, since one barista is not limited to steaming a single pitcher at a time.

Mypresso Auto Super-Automatic System

The Mypresso Auto is a bean-to-cup machine that grinds, doses, tamps, brews, and can froth milk automatically from a single button press. It is oriented toward locations where staff turnover is high or where consistent output with minimal training is prioritized.

The system can store up to 30 saved recipes, allowing different drink profiles to be recalled without manual adjustment between orders.

Milk Heating and Frothing

The Mypresso Auto's milk system is oriented toward a target temperature of approximately 65°C for heated milk drinks. Actual result depends on the milk type, starting temperature, and the amount poured.

Automatic milk texture will not match a hand-steamed microfoam in every recipe; if a specific latte art texture is required, this should be tested against the business's milk and cup size before relying on the automatic program.

Water Tank and Plumb-In Option

The Mypresso Auto ships with an 8-liter water tank and can optionally be connected directly to the mains water line. A plumbed connection reduces the need to refill the tank during service but requires suitable water infrastructure and filtration at the installation site.

Water hardness should be checked and a filtration or softening system used as needed, since scale buildup can affect both traditional and automatic machines over time.

Pre-Infusion and Americano Bypass

Like the Q2 TC, the Mypresso Auto applies pre-infusion before full brew pressure. An Americano bypass function is oriented toward adding hot water directly to an espresso shot without routing it back through the coffee puck, which helps keep the drink's flavor profile more consistent.

Puck Bin Infrared Sensor

The Mypresso Auto's puck bin uses an infrared sensor to detect fill level and can alert staff before the bin overflows. This does not replace a scheduled emptying routine during high-volume service; the bin should still be checked periodically rather than relying on the sensor alone.

How Should You Choose Between the Q2 TC and Mypresso Auto?

The Q2 TC should be considered where a trained barista team wants manual control over grind, dose, and steaming. The Mypresso Auto should be considered where consistency, speed, and lower training requirements are the priority.

Daily cup volume, staff experience level, and menu variety should all factor into the decision, rather than choosing based on machine size or price alone.
